1999 Chevy Malibu 4 cyl Automatic

My 99 Chevy Malibu has been having starting issues. It cranks up but won't start. Sometimes it will start and immediately shut off. All of my dashboard lights seem to come on (including check engine light, brake, ABS, check oil, everything). I get regular oil changes and keep up my maintenance. I took it to a local mechanic shop and they were not able to find anything wrong with my vehicle. They said they can't really figure it out because it only not starts sometimes and not to worry about the lights coming on because its normal?????? idk about that...I thought it may have some type of electrical issue because when I turn on my windshield wipers, they will not go off! I can turn the car off and turn it back on and sometimes the wipers will still be on. Sometimes they only go off when I spray out the windshield wiper fluid. Any help or suggestions, especially with the no starting issue, would be appreciated. Thanks

alot fo times codes are not shown but the cam position sensor or crank position sensor go bad. They will need to check those for ohms to see if they have a problem. The windshield wiper has either lost it's ground in the motor which can be resoldered but has to be taken out to fix.
